Biography
Michael Logan is an American jazz bassist. He worked with, among others, Muhal Richard Abrams, Walter Bishop Jr., Artie Simmons and the Jazz Samaritans, and Clifford Jordan. In 1974 he collaborated with the Italian singer-songwriter and musician Giuni Russo in writing her first album, Love Is a Woman (1975), entirely in English. In particular, he wrote the entire song Every Time You Leave.
